San Sebastian is a famous beach resort in the north of Spain with picturesque coastline, vibrant nightlife and amazing Basque gastronomy.
Playa de la Concha is one of the world’s most popular city beaches, ideal for watersports lovers. Rent a surfboard on Zurriola beach or just relax on a cosy lounge chair under your umbrella.
Established as the culinary capital of Spain, San Sebastian features a variety of bars and restaurants serving delicious pintxos (Basque-style tapas), fresh seafood and fine wine. According to Spanish tradition, you should have one tapa and a wine in one bar, then move on to the next bar.
The tree-covered hill standing just across the gulf is called Urgull and offers spectacular views over the bay and city. Situated at the bottom of it, Parte Vieja is the old part of the town where you can mix with the locals and visit some of the city’s most interesting historical attractions.
San Sebastian Airport is located 20 km east, so it's a short journey into the city itself. Booking.com offers a choice of accommodation ranging from luxury hotels to guest houses, apartments and budget hostels.

San Sebastian is really a great city for views: you have 2 mountains accessible on foot with great views on the bay (concha), the city and the ocean. There is also nice architecture (Art Nouveau), a great basque history/art museum (San Telmo) and a maritime museum with an aquarium.
And there is a great beach for surfing (Zurriola). So on the boulevards you can see side by side a surfer with surfboard and a very smartly dressed couple walking toward the Kuursaal.
